A spring clean and litter pick in Ramsey organised by Faith in Action for Mann has the support of Ramsey Town Commissioners, said Commissioners’ chairman Captain Nigel Malpass.
Sunday March 24th has been chosen as the day when teams of volunteers are set to target a number of litter ‘hot spots’ around the town.
Captain Malpass said: ‘The Commissioners applaud the efforts of Faith in Action to help rid the town of the blight of litter and encourage greater civic pride. With the Commission and Ramsey Chamber of Commerce involved this initiative is an example of partnership working at its most practical. Litter is a community problem that demands a community response.’
